About Greenmeadows Intermediate
Greenmeadows Intermediate, nestled in the heart of Manurewa within Auckland, is a vibrant state-run co-educational intermediate that has firmly established itself as an inclusive and diverse learning community. With approximately 347 students from various cultural backgrounds—including significant representation with 31% Pacific heritage and 28% Asian descent—Greenmeadows Intermediate fosters a rich multicultural environment where every child's unique identity is celebrated.
